diff options
| author | Marcel Moolenaar <marcel@FreeBSD.org> | 2014-07-07 00:27:09 +0000 |
|---|---|---|
| committer | Marcel Moolenaar <marcel@FreeBSD.org> | 2014-07-07 00:27:09 +0000 |
| commit | e7d939bda22b07be6b68ba38835c9167212fd56e (patch) | |
| tree | 98db2559cee662a9de7212211dd5c69176b58254 /gnu/usr.bin/binutils | |
| parent | 00cf40b0ca010cb2a6afb112650109dcabe80dea (diff) | |
Notes
Diffstat (limited to 'gnu/usr.bin/binutils')
| -rw-r--r-- | gnu/usr.bin/binutils/as/ia64-freebsd/targ-cpu.h | 3 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/ld/Makefile | 4 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/ld/Makefile.ia64 | 24 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/ld/elf64_ia64_fbsd.sh | 8 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/libbfd/Makefile | 2 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/libbfd/Makefile.ia64 | 35 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/libbfd/bfd.h | 2 | ||||
| -rw-r--r-- | gnu/usr.bin/binutils/libopcodes/Makefile.ia64 | 4 |
8 files changed, 2 insertions, 80 deletions
diff --git a/gnu/usr.bin/binutils/as/ia64-freebsd/targ-cpu.h b/gnu/usr.bin/binutils/as/ia64-freebsd/targ-cpu.h deleted file mode 100644 index a0a6360d68e08..0000000000000 --- a/gnu/usr.bin/binutils/as/ia64-freebsd/targ-cpu.h +++ /dev/null @@ -1,3 +0,0 @@ -/* $FreeBSD$ */ - -#include "tc-ia64.h" diff --git a/gnu/usr.bin/binutils/ld/Makefile b/gnu/usr.bin/binutils/ld/Makefile index 81a46d5d21b0b..6c59945808a24 100644 --- a/gnu/usr.bin/binutils/ld/Makefile +++ b/gnu/usr.bin/binutils/ld/Makefile @@ -5,10 +5,6 @@ .PATH: ${SRCDIR}/ld -.if ${TARGET_ARCH} == "ia64" -CFLAGS+= -O1 -.endif - PROG= ld SCRIPTDIR= /usr/libdata/ldscripts SRCS+= ldcref.c \ diff --git a/gnu/usr.bin/binutils/ld/Makefile.ia64 b/gnu/usr.bin/binutils/ld/Makefile.ia64 deleted file mode 100644 index 50a7bb63a63b4..0000000000000 --- a/gnu/usr.bin/binutils/ld/Makefile.ia64 +++ /dev/null @@ -1,24 +0,0 @@ -# $FreeBSD$ - -NATIVE_EMULATION= elf64_ia64_fbsd - -SRCS+= e${NATIVE_EMULATION}.c -CLEANFILES+= e${NATIVE_EMULATION}.c -e${NATIVE_EMULATION}.c: ${.CURDIR}/${NATIVE_EMULATION}.sh emultempl/elf32.em \ - scripttempl/elf.sc genscripts.sh stringify.sed - sh ${.CURDIR}/genscripts.sh ${SRCDIR}/ld ${LIBSEARCHPATH} \ - ${TOOLS_PREFIX}/usr \ - ${HOST} ${TARGET_TUPLE} ${TARGET_TUPLE} \ - ${NATIVE_EMULATION} "" no ${NATIVE_EMULATION} ${TARGET_TUPLE} \ - ${.CURDIR}/${NATIVE_EMULATION}.sh - -#XXX EMS+= eelf64_ia64 - -SRCS+= eelf64_ia64.c -CLEANFILES+= eelf64_ia64.c -eelf64_ia64.c: emulparams/elf64_ia64.sh emultempl/elf32.em \ - scripttempl/elf.sc genscripts.sh stringify.sed - sh ${.CURDIR}/genscripts.sh ${SRCDIR}/ld ${LIBSEARCHPATH} \ - ${TOOLS_PREFIX}/usr \ - ${HOST} ${TARGET_TUPLE} ${TARGET_TUPLE} \ - elf64_ia64 "" no elf64_ia64 ${TARGET_TUPLE} diff --git a/gnu/usr.bin/binutils/ld/elf64_ia64_fbsd.sh b/gnu/usr.bin/binutils/ld/elf64_ia64_fbsd.sh deleted file mode 100644 index 213b494736f53..0000000000000 --- a/gnu/usr.bin/binutils/ld/elf64_ia64_fbsd.sh +++ /dev/null @@ -1,8 +0,0 @@ -# $FreeBSD$ -. ${srcdir}/emulparams/elf64_ia64.sh -TEXT_START_ADDR="0x0000000100000000" -unset DATA_ADDR -unset SMALL_DATA_CTOR -unset SMALL_DATA_DTOR -. ${srcdir}/emulparams/elf_fbsd.sh -OUTPUT_FORMAT="elf64-ia64-freebsd" diff --git a/gnu/usr.bin/binutils/libbfd/Makefile b/gnu/usr.bin/binutils/libbfd/Makefile index ca5e1838ac54d..a24dd045bec5f 100644 --- a/gnu/usr.bin/binutils/libbfd/Makefile +++ b/gnu/usr.bin/binutils/libbfd/Makefile @@ -42,7 +42,7 @@ SRCS+= archive.c \ targets.c \ targmatch.h \ tekhex.c -.if (${TARGET_ARCH} == "ia64" || ${TARGET_ARCH} == "sparc64") +.if ${TARGET_ARCH} == "sparc64" WARNS?= 2 .endif CFLAGS+= -D_GNU_SOURCE diff --git a/gnu/usr.bin/binutils/libbfd/Makefile.ia64 b/gnu/usr.bin/binutils/libbfd/Makefile.ia64 deleted file mode 100644 index 2e489bcc62e59..0000000000000 --- a/gnu/usr.bin/binutils/libbfd/Makefile.ia64 +++ /dev/null @@ -1,35 +0,0 @@ -# $FreeBSD$ - -DEFAULT_VECTOR= bfd_elf64_ia64_freebsd_vec - -SRCS+= cofflink.c \ - cpu-ia64.c \ - efi-app-ia64.c \ - elf32.c \ - elf32-gen.c \ - elf32-target.h \ - elf64.c \ - elf64-gen.c \ - elf64-ia64.c \ - elf64-target.h \ - elflink.c \ - pepigen.c \ - pex64igen.c - -VECS+= ${DEFAULT_VECTOR} \ - bfd_efi_app_ia64_vec \ - bfd_elf64_ia64_little_vec \ - bfd_elf64_ia64_big_vec \ - bfd_elf64_little_generic_vec bfd_elf64_big_generic_vec \ - bfd_elf32_little_generic_vec bfd_elf32_big_generic_vec - -CLEANFILES+= elf64-ia64.c pepigen.c pex64igen.c - -elf64-ia64.c: elfxx-ia64.c - sed -e s/NN/64/g ${.ALLSRC} > ${.TARGET} - -pepigen.c: peXXigen.c - sed -e s/XX/pep/g ${.ALLSRC} > ${.TARGET} - -pex64igen.c: peXXigen.c - sed -e s/XX/pex64/g ${.ALLSRC} > ${.TARGET} diff --git a/gnu/usr.bin/binutils/libbfd/bfd.h b/gnu/usr.bin/binutils/libbfd/bfd.h index c9dfef54ae267..f65123351d7ca 100644 --- a/gnu/usr.bin/binutils/libbfd/bfd.h +++ b/gnu/usr.bin/binutils/libbfd/bfd.h @@ -85,7 +85,7 @@ extern "C" { #define BFD_HOST_64BIT_LONG 0 #define BFD_HOST_64_BIT long long #define BFD_HOST_U_64_BIT unsigned long long -#elif defined(__alpha__) || defined(__sparc64__) || defined(__amd64__) || defined(__ia64__) +#elif defined(__alpha__) || defined(__sparc64__) || defined(__amd64__) #define BFD_HOST_64BIT_LONG 1 #define BFD_HOST_64_BIT long #define BFD_HOST_U_64_BIT unsigned long diff --git a/gnu/usr.bin/binutils/libopcodes/Makefile.ia64 b/gnu/usr.bin/binutils/libopcodes/Makefile.ia64 deleted file mode 100644 index 98198cdea1095..0000000000000 --- a/gnu/usr.bin/binutils/libopcodes/Makefile.ia64 +++ /dev/null @@ -1,4 +0,0 @@ -# $FreeBSD$ - -SRCS+= ia64-dis.c ia64-opc.c -CFLAGS+= -DARCH_ia64 |
